The government has long recognized the vital role of cottage industries in the countryside development of the Philippines

Aurora Province, with its vast natural resources where raw materials are available has bright potential in cottage industry development.

Available materials in the province includes sabutan, coconut by-products, nipa, bamboo, wood, rattan, shell, sand, puroy and gravel for concrete products and fruits for good processing.

Most of the cottage industries operating in Aurora is on job order basis which means that production is dependent on the order of the customer.

In support to the project, the Department of Trade and Industry (DTI), is extending various financial assistance to cottage and small and medium industries. Aside from this, the department is also helping the small entrepreneurs find the right market for their products. Producers, particularly in furniture and handicraft industry prefer to sell their products outside the province for better prices.
